Major Challenges Facing Global Supply Chains in the Post-Pandemic Era

The COVID-19 pandemic fundamentally reshaped how businesses and governments think about supply chains. Even years later, in 2026, many of the vulnerabilities exposed during that period continue to influence global logistics. Here's a comprehensive overview of the key challenges:

1. Geopolitical Tensions and Trade Fragmentation

  • US-China decoupling: Ongoing trade restrictions, tariffs, and export controls (especially on semiconductors and advanced technology) have forced companies to restructure sourcing strategies.
  • Regional conflicts: Disruptions in key shipping corridors—such as the Red Sea/Suez Canal region—have forced costly rerouting of vessels, adding weeks to transit times.
  • Sanctions regimes: Companies must navigate increasingly complex compliance requirements across multiple jurisdictions.

2. The Shift from "Just-in-Time" to "Just-in-Case"

  • The pandemic revealed the fragility of lean inventory models. Many firms now hold larger safety stocks, which ties up capital and increases warehousing costs.
  • Balancing resilience versus efficiency remains a core strategic dilemma—redundancy is expensive, but disruption is more expensive.

3. Reshoring, Nearshoring, and "Friendshoring"

  • Companies are diversifying away from single-country dependence (the "China+1" strategy), moving production to places like Vietnam, India, Mexico, and Eastern Europe.
  • Challenges: New locations often lack the deep supplier ecosystems, infrastructure, and skilled labor pools that took decades to build in established manufacturing hubs.

4. Labor Shortages and Workforce Issues

  • Persistent shortages of truck drivers, dock workers, and warehouse staff in many developed economies.
  • An aging workforce in logistics and manufacturing sectors.
  • Labor disputes and strikes at major ports periodically disrupting cargo flows.

5. Rising Costs and Inflationary Pressures

  • Elevated freight rates (though volatile), higher energy costs, and increased insurance premiums for shipping through risky corridors.
  • Wage inflation across logistics sectors passing through to consumer prices.

6. Climate Change and Extreme Weather

  • Physical disruptions: Droughts affecting canal operations (e.g., the Panama Canal's water-level restrictions), floods, hurricanes, and wildfires damaging infrastructure.
  • Regulatory pressure: Carbon border taxes (like the EU's CBAM), emissions reporting requirements, and decarbonization mandates for shipping (IMO regulations) are adding compliance costs and complexity.

7. Technology and Cybersecurity Risks

  • Greater digitalization of supply chains increases exposure to ransomware and cyberattacks targeting ports, carriers, and logistics software providers.
  • The challenge of achieving end-to-end visibility—many companies still lack real-time insight beyond their tier-1 suppliers.

8. Semiconductor and Critical Materials Dependence

  • Continued vulnerability in supplies of chips, rare earth elements, lithium, and other critical minerals essential for electronics, EVs, and renewable energy.
  • Concentration of processing capacity in a small number of countries creates chokepoints.

9. Demand Volatility and Forecasting Difficulty

  • Post-pandemic consumption patterns remain harder to predict, with rapid swings between goods and services spending.
  • The "bullwhip effect"—where small demand changes amplify up the supply chain—continues to cause inventory gluts and shortages.

10. Regulatory Complexity and Supply Chain Due Diligence

  • New laws requiring companies to verify their supply chains are free of forced labor (e.g., the US Uyghur Forced Labor Prevention Act) and meet environmental and human rights standards (e.g., the EU's Corporate Sustainability Due Diligence Directive).
  • This demands unprecedented transparency into multi-tier supplier networks.

How Companies Are Responding

  • Diversification: Multi-sourcing and geographic spread of suppliers.
  • Digitalization: AI-driven demand forecasting, digital twins, and blockchain-based traceability.
  • Vertical integration: Some firms bringing critical production in-house.
  • Strategic stockpiling: Especially for critical components and materials.
  • Collaborative planning: Deeper data-sharing partnerships with suppliers and logistics providers.

As of 2026, global supply chains are no longer dealing with the acute shock of the pandemic, but they are still adjusting to a more volatile, fragmented, and risk-sensitive operating environment. The major challenges include:

1. Persistent demand volatility

Many companies still struggle to forecast demand accurately. During the pandemic, consumer spending shifted sharply toward goods, then partially back toward services. Since then, inflation, interest rates, uneven economic growth, and changing consumer habits have made demand harder to predict.

This creates problems such as:

  • Overstocking in some categories
  • Shortages in others
  • Higher warehousing costs
  • More frequent markdowns and inventory write-offs
  • Difficulty planning production and transport capacity

2. Geopolitical tensions and trade fragmentation

Supply chains are increasingly affected by geopolitical risk. Tensions involving the U.S., China, Europe, Russia, Taiwan, and the Middle East have pushed companies to rethink where they source and manufacture goods.

Key issues include:

  • Tariffs and export controls
  • Sanctions and trade restrictions
  • Limits on technology transfer, especially in semiconductors and advanced manufacturing
  • Political pressure to “reshore,” “nearshore,” or “friend-shore” production
  • Higher compliance costs due to changing trade rules

Many firms are moving from a purely cost-driven supply chain model to one that prioritizes resilience and geopolitical risk management.

3. Overdependence on single regions or suppliers

The pandemic exposed the risks of relying too heavily on one country, one supplier, or one logistics route. China remains central to many global supply chains, but companies are increasingly pursuing “China+1” strategies by adding production in countries such as Vietnam, India, Mexico, Thailand, Indonesia, and parts of Eastern Europe.

However, diversification is difficult because:

  • Alternative locations may lack infrastructure or skilled labor
  • Supplier ecosystems take years to develop
  • Moving production can raise costs
  • Quality control may become harder
  • Regulatory and customs complexity increases

4. Higher transportation and logistics uncertainty

Although freight rates have come down from pandemic peaks, logistics networks remain vulnerable. Disruptions can come from port congestion, labor strikes, extreme weather, shipping route disruptions, or geopolitical conflict.

Examples of continuing risks include:

  • Red Sea and Suez Canal disruptions
  • Panama Canal drought-related restrictions
  • Port labor disputes
  • Trucking and rail bottlenecks
  • Container imbalances
  • Rising insurance and security costs for some routes

Companies are therefore holding more buffer stock or using more expensive transport options, which can raise total supply chain costs.

5. Inflation and cost pressure

Supply chains face higher costs for labor, energy, raw materials, insurance, financing, and transportation compared with the pre-pandemic period. Even when some commodity prices fall, companies may still face structural cost increases.

This creates pressure to:

  • Negotiate harder with suppliers
  • Automate operations
  • Redesign products to use cheaper or more available materials
  • Pass costs to customers where possible
  • Reduce inventory without increasing shortage risk

The challenge is balancing cost efficiency with resilience.

6. Labor shortages and skills gaps

Many supply chain sectors continue to face labor constraints. Warehousing, trucking, manufacturing, shipping, and logistics operations often struggle to attract and retain workers.

At the same time, supply chains increasingly need workers with skills in:

  • Data analytics
  • Robotics and automation
  • Procurement risk management
  • Cybersecurity
  • AI-enabled planning systems
  • Sustainability reporting

This means companies face both a shortage of workers in physical operations and a shortage of specialized digital supply chain talent.

7. Inventory strategy: just-in-time vs. just-in-case

Before the pandemic, many firms relied heavily on lean, just-in-time inventory systems. These reduced costs but left little room for disruption. Since then, companies have been trying to build more resilient inventory strategies.

The challenge is that more inventory means:

  • Higher working capital requirements
  • Higher storage costs
  • Greater risk of obsolescence
  • More complex planning

But too little inventory increases the risk of stockouts and lost sales. Many firms are now trying to identify which products require redundancy and which can remain lean.

8. Supplier financial health and resilience

Smaller suppliers remain vulnerable to higher interest rates, rising input costs, labor shortages, and delayed payments. If a key supplier fails, the effects can ripple through the entire supply chain.

Companies increasingly need to monitor:

  • Supplier liquidity
  • Geographic concentration
  • Tier-2 and tier-3 suppliers
  • Exposure to political or climate risk
  • Compliance with labor and environmental standards

The problem is that many companies still lack visibility beyond their direct suppliers.

9. Limited end-to-end visibility

A major post-pandemic lesson is that many firms do not fully understand their supply chains beyond the first tier. This makes it difficult to detect problems early.

Visibility challenges include:

  • Fragmented data systems
  • Poor supplier transparency
  • Inconsistent tracking standards
  • Limited real-time logistics data
  • Difficulty mapping sub-suppliers
  • Data-sharing reluctance among partners

Companies are investing in digital control towers, AI forecasting, IoT tracking, and supplier mapping, but implementation can be expensive and complex.

10. Cybersecurity risks

As supply chains become more digital and interconnected, cyber risk has become a major concern. A cyberattack on a logistics provider, port operator, supplier, or software platform can disrupt entire supply networks.

Risks include:

  • Ransomware attacks
  • Theft of intellectual property
  • Disruption of warehouse or transport systems
  • Compromise of supplier portals
  • Attacks on critical infrastructure

Supply chain cybersecurity is especially difficult because a company’s risk depends not only on its own systems, but also on the security of its suppliers and logistics partners.

11. Climate change and extreme weather

Extreme weather is now a recurring supply chain risk. Floods, droughts, wildfires, hurricanes, heat waves, and storms can disrupt production, transportation, agriculture, and energy supply.

Climate-related challenges include:

  • Factory shutdowns
  • Crop failures
  • Water shortages affecting manufacturing and shipping
  • Damage to roads, ports, and rail networks
  • Higher insurance costs
  • Pressure to redesign networks for climate resilience

The Panama Canal drought and repeated disruptions in major agricultural regions illustrate how climate risk can directly affect trade flows.

12. Sustainability and regulatory pressure

Governments, investors, and consumers are demanding more sustainable and ethical supply chains. Companies face growing requirements to track emissions, prevent forced labor, reduce waste, and prove responsible sourcing.

Important areas include:

  • Carbon emissions reporting
  • Scope 3 emissions from suppliers
  • Forced labor regulations
  • Deforestation-free supply chain rules
  • Battery and critical mineral traceability
  • Packaging waste reduction
  • Circular economy requirements

Compliance can be difficult because environmental and labor data often comes from deep within the supplier network.

13. Semiconductor, energy, and critical mineral dependencies

The pandemic and subsequent geopolitical tensions highlighted vulnerabilities in strategic industries. Semiconductors, batteries, rare earths, lithium, cobalt, nickel, pharmaceuticals, and energy infrastructure components remain especially sensitive.

Challenges include:

  • Concentrated production in a few countries
  • Long lead times for new capacity
  • Resource nationalism
  • Export restrictions
  • High capital investment requirements
  • Competition between governments and industries for secure supply

These issues are particularly important for electric vehicles, renewable energy, defense, telecommunications, and advanced electronics.

14. Technology adoption and integration challenges

Companies are adopting AI, automation, robotics, blockchain, digital twins, and predictive analytics to improve resilience. However, technology alone does not solve supply chain problems.

Common barriers include:

  • Legacy IT systems
  • Poor-quality data
  • Lack of integration between suppliers and customers
  • High implementation costs
  • Shortage of technical talent
  • Organizational resistance to change

The most successful firms combine technology with better processes, governance, and supplier collaboration.

15. Balancing resilience with efficiency

Perhaps the biggest overall challenge is finding the right balance between cost efficiency and resilience. Pre-pandemic supply chains were often optimized for low cost and speed. Post-pandemic supply chains must also account for disruption risk.

This means companies are rethinking:

  • Where they manufacture
  • How many suppliers they use
  • How much inventory they hold
  • Which markets they prioritize
  • How they manage logistics routes
  • How they evaluate supplier risk
  • How much redundancy they can afford

The trade-off is clear: resilience usually costs more, but lack of resilience can be far more expensive during a crisis.

Bottom line

The post-pandemic era has shifted global supply chains from a model focused mainly on efficiency to one focused on resilience, visibility, flexibility, and risk management. Companies are not abandoning globalization, but they are redesigning supply networks to be less fragile, more diversified, more digital, and better prepared for geopolitical, climate, cyber, and demand shocks.

Here are the issues supply-chain managers, investors and governments are wrestling with most often today, roughly in the order they surface in board-room conversations:

  1. Geopolitical fragmentation
    • U.S.–China strategic rivalry, Russia-Ukraine war, and a growing number of export-control regimes have turned what used to be pure cost/efficiency networks into instruments of national power.
    • Dual or “China-plus-one” sourcing strategies raise complexity and CAPEX, while sanctions and countersanctions add legal and reputational risk.

  2. Supply-side concentration (“single-point-of-failure” risk)
    • A handful of firms or regions still dominate key inputs: TSMC for advanced chips, the DRC for cobalt, Xinjiang for polysilicon, South-East Asia for packaging and testing.
    • Natural-disaster and political-instability maps are forcing companies to redesign footprint models around resilience rather than labour-arbitrage alone.

  3. Transportation volatility
    • Container rates collapsed from 2021 highs, but capacity remains tight because shipping lines have cancelled sailings to prop up prices.
    • Labour disputes at U.S. West-Coast ports, drought-driven draft limits in the Panama Canal and Red-Sea security incidents keep lead times unpredictable.

  4. Inventory-to-demand mismatch
    • Bullwhip effects created excess inventories in apparel, electronics and furniture just as consumer spending rotated to services.
    • Working-capital strain is acute for SMEs that cannot finance 90-day ocean voyages and 60-day customer terms simultaneously.

  5. Regulatory & ESG pressure
    • EU CBAM, German Lieferkettengesetz and U.S. UFLPA require end-to-end traceability and proof of labour and carbon compliance down to Tier-3 suppliers.
    • Data collection, verification and reporting are still largely manual for most firms, increasing audit costs and recall risk.

  6. Talent and digitisation gaps
    • Retirements in logistics/warehousing and a shortage of data engineers slow down adoption of control-tower, AI-based forecasting and digital-twin tools.
    • Cyber-security incidents (e.g., MOVEit, ransomware at logistics providers) underline the need for secure cloud integration.

  7. Rising cost of capital
    • Interest-rate hikes make buffer-inventory and near-shoring CAPEX relatively expensive, challenging ROI calculations for regionalised production.

  8. Climate change & extreme weather
    • Typhoons, floods and wildfires disrupt nodes unpredictably; insurance premiums climb, and carbon-pricing schemes alter total-landed-cost equations.
    • Companies are experimenting with parametric insurance and scenario-planning via climate digital twins.

  9. Consumer expectation for speed and transparency
    • “Next-day” and “track-and-trace” are considered table stakes in B2C and increasingly in B2B, forcing investment in last-mile solutions and real-time data sharing with partners.

  10. Technology lock-in and standards battles
    • Competing IoT and blockchain platforms, and the lack of common data taxonomies, generate integration headaches and limit network-wide visibility.

Practical responses that leading firms are taking: • Multi-sourcing with “flex capacity” contracts.
• Near-shoring for time-critical SKUs while keeping Asia for volume production.
• Control towers that merge demand, inventory and transport data in near-real time.
• Scenario-based network modelling (geopolitical, climate, cost-of-capital axes).
• Supplier-enablement programs, including financing and shared ESG audits.

The post-pandemic era isn’t just about “fixing” supply chains; it’s about redesigning them for a world where resilience, sustainability and geopolitics weigh as much as pure cost.
